What is Amoxicillin, Clavulanic Acid?
Co-Amoxiclav is a combination antibiotic containing amoxicillin and clavulanic acid, used to treat bacterial infections. It is administered intravenously for effective infection control.
What is Amoxicillin, Clavulanic Acid used for?
Co-Amoxiclav is primarily used to treat a wide range of bacterial infections. The combination of amoxicillin and clavulanic acid works to combat bacteria that may be resistant to other antibiotics. It is often prescribed for infections in the respiratory tract, urinary tract, skin, and soft tissues. Patients may wonder, 'What is Co-Amoxiclav used for?' and the answer is that it is effective against various bacterial infections that require intravenous treatment.
What are the side effects of Amoxicillin, Clavulanic Acid?
Common effects of Co-Amoxiclav may include mild to moderate gastrointestinal disturbances such as diarrhea, nausea, and vomiting. Some patients may experience allergic reactions, although these are less common. It is important to monitor for any signs of adverse reactions and consult a healthcare provider if they occur.
What precautions apply to Amoxicillin, Clavulanic Acid?
Co-Amoxiclav should be used with caution in patients with a history of allergic reactions to penicillin or other antibiotics. It is important to follow the prescribed dosage and administration instructions to minimize the risk of side effects. Patients with kidney or liver impairments should inform their healthcare provider before using this medication.
What does Amoxicillin, Clavulanic Acid interact with?
Co-Amoxiclav may interact with certain medications, including other antibiotics, blood thinners, and some antacids. It is advisable to inform your healthcare provider about all medications you are taking to avoid potential interactions. Alcohol consumption should be avoided while using Co-Amoxiclav to prevent adverse effects.
